WebPeople who have GAD experience persistent and excessive worry and have been worried most of the time for at least 6 months. They worry about at least two topics. GAD sufferers tend to have chronic worries about real life situations such as: finances, the health of family members, housework, being late for appointments and losing one’s job. http://cedar.exeter.ac.uk/media/universityofexeter/schoolofpsychology/cedar/documents/liiapt/Managing_Your_Worries.pdf

WebApr 11, 2024 · What is Anxiety? Anxiety is a feeling of worry, on edge or unease about future events or situations. It is a natural response to stress and danger, and it can manifest physically as well as emotionally. Symptoms of anxiety may include increased heart rate, sweating, trembling, difficulty breathing, and a sense of impending doom.
